Output dc90da3f104c7f812480df54bf464176072e45460601c0abc53511201eefecc1:24

value
1150000
script pubkey
OP_0 OP_PUSHBYTES_20 6995802cd7dc247aec08779a8d53d02464256a2a
address
ltc1qdx2cqtxhmsj84mqgw7dg657sy3jz2632gys9eq
transaction
dc90da3f104c7f812480df54bf464176072e45460601c0abc53511201eefecc1
spent
true